Typical Appliance Issues: An Introduction
Devices play an important role in modern-day families, yet they commonly experience concerns that disrupt their functionality. Common issues vary throughout various types of home appliances, however particular concerns are frequently observed. Refrigerators may experience cooling failings, usually due to blocked vents or malfunctioning thermostats. Washing machines may refuse to spin or drain pipes, commonly connected to clogged tubes or malfunctioning pumps. Stoves can display irregular home heating, which may come from defective temperature level sensing units or heating aspects. Dishwashing machines may leave recipes unclean, often because of blocked spray arms or malfunctioning filters. Additionally, dryers might face issues such as overheating or falling short to begin, commonly triggered by lint build-up or damaged thermostats. Understanding these typical appliance problems can assist house owners recognize when expert fixing services are essential, making certain that their appliances operate successfully and effectively.

Straightforward Troubleshooting Tips
How can home owners successfully troubleshoot minor appliance problems prior to calling an expert? Initially, checking the source of power is necessary; making certain that the appliance is plugged in and that breaker are undamaged can fix numerous concerns. Next, house owners must evaluate for blockages or blockages, particularly in appliances like dishwashing machines and clothes dryers. Cleaning filters and vents can considerably boost performance. In addition, speaking with the appliance's handbook for mistake codes or troubleshooting guides can give fast remedies. Resetting the appliance, if appropriate, may additionally solve small glitches. Maintaining a log of persisting issues can assist determine patterns, potentially leading to simple repair work or maintenance. These actions can equip property owners to resolve small appliance concerns properly.

Tools for Repair services
Having the right devices is crucial for home owners dealing with medium-level appliance repairs. A fully equipped tool kit can significantly simplify the repair service procedure. Fundamental tools normally consist of screwdrivers, pliers, and wrenches, which enable different changes and part replacements. A multimeter is essential for detecting electric problems, while a socket set can be important for working with nuts and bolts. Furthermore, a torque wrench guarantees that bolts Learn More are effectively tightened up to maker specifications. Safety and security gear, such as gloves and safety glasses, need to not be neglected, as they shield against injuries. For more complicated fixings, specialized tools like a vacuum pump or a refrigerant scale might be needed. Buying top quality tools ultimately boosts repair service performance and performance.
Determining Electric Problems: Safety First
When dealing with appliance repair, focusing on security is crucial, especially when recognizing electric problems. Electric devices position significant risks, consisting of shock and fire risks. Prior to beginning any type of assessment or fixing, one must ensure that the appliance is unplugged and that the work area is dry view and free from obstructions.The use protected tools is highly recommended, as they can prevent accidental shocks. Furthermore, it is very important to inspect for visible damages, such as torn cords or burnt-out components, which can indicate underlying issues.Multimeters can be used to check voltage levels and connection, yet only after confirming that the appliance is de-energized. Wearing individual safety equipment, such as rubber handwear covers, adds an added layer of security.

Preventive Upkeep: Keeping Your Home Appliances Healthy And Balanced
Keeping home appliances through regular preventive treatment assurances their long life and optimal efficiency. Regular upkeep tasks, such as cleaning filters and coils, examining seals, and lubing relocating parts, can substantially decrease the probability of malfunctions. Homeowners should familiarize themselves with their devices' individual handbooks, which often offer particular maintenance guidelines.Additionally, organizing regular specialist examinations can help identify potential concerns before they rise right into expensive fixings. For example, a home appliance professional can find inadequacies go in fridges and washers that might go unnoticed by the typical user.Keeping devices clean and without debris not only boosts their performance however also contributes to energy savings. Simple practices, such as regularly clearing lint traps in clothes dryers and thawing fridges freezer, can protect against operational issues. By prioritizing preventive maintenance, house owners can extend the life of their devices and assurance they run effectively with time.
